Study On Multistage Slugs For In-depth Channeling Plugging In Steam Huff Puff Wells Of Heavy Oil Reservoir

According to the problems of steam channeling in the late oil extraction process of steam huff puff wells,channeling plugging agents have been studied.However,traditional channeling plugging agents were utilized singly and not effectively solved the problems of deep channeling plugging.Taking the optimization of slug formula and cost saving as the starting point,temperature distribution of heavy oil reservoir is analyzed,and combination of in-depth profile control slugs in steam huff puff wells of heavy oil reservoir was studied.Based on numerical simulation method,temperature distribution in high permeability layer of the heavy oil reservoir was analyzed,ultra high temperature zone(>250°C),high temperature zone(130~250°C),middle temperature zone(90~130°C)and low temperature zone(<90°C)were divided.Inorganic plugging agents of temperature resistance recommended to be used in ultra high temperature zone was not studied.In this paper,slugs of temperature resistance adapt to the other three temperature zones were studied to achieve the purpose of multistage channeling plugging.Solubility and viscosity concentration relationship of alkali lignin,tannin extract and polymer were studied,and the effects of polymer,cross-linking agents and additive agents concentrations on gelling property were evaluated with the method of bottle test experiment.The best formulas of channeling plugging slugs were confirmed.Appropriate formula of high temperature zone is 4~7% tannin extract XW + 1~2.5% cross-linking agent REL + 1~2.5% cross-linking agent MNE + 3.0% inorganic strengthening agent,that of middle temperature zone is 1.5~2% AWW + 0.6~1.0% cross-linking agent REL + 0.6~1.0% cross-linking agent MNE + 0.2~0.3% accelerator,that of low temperature zone is 1.5~2% AWW + 0.2~0.4% crosslinking agent REL + 0.2~0.3% cross-linking agent PNE + 0.07~0.15% accelerator.The application performances are studied with physical simulation trails.The experiments show that it is thermophilic and has good easy-to-injectivity,plugging property,flushing resistance and good selectivity.Performance prediction shows that after the injection of channeling plugging slugs,steam huff puff well adds two cysles of oil recovery and can achieve good effect of water control and oil production.
